### 内容大纲 1. **引言** - 比特币的概述 - 钱包在比特币网络中的作用 - 地址生成的重要性 2. **比特币钱包的类型** - 热钱包与冷钱包 - 软件钱包与硬件钱包 - 纸钱包的介绍 3. **比特币地址的构成** - 地址的基础知识 - 不同类型的比特币地址(P2PKH, P2SH, Bech32等) - 地址与公钥、私钥的关系 4. **比特币地址生成的过程** - 钱包如何生成私钥 - 如何从私钥生成公钥 - 地址的哈希和编码过程 5. **无数个地址的优势与必要性** - 隐私保护 - 防止地址重用的风险 - 管理多个账户的灵活性 6. **常见问题解答** - 为什么比特币钱包能生成无数个地址? - 如何管理和使用多个比特币地址? - 比特币的地址与交易的安全性关系是什么? - 是否可以从比特币地址恢复私钥? - 地址生成的随机性如何保证? - 如何选择适合自己的比特币钱包? 7. **总结** - 地址生成的关键意义 - 对未来比特币钱包发展的展望 ### 1. 引言

      比特币,自 2009 年诞生以来,已成为全球数百万人的数字资产存储和交易工具。它采用了去中心化的区块链技术,这意味着没有中央银行或政府控制比特币的发行和交易。与此同时,比特币的钱包作为用户与区块链互动的桥梁,起着至关重要的作用。

      本文将深入探讨比特币钱包生成无数个地址的原理和过程,以及这种设计背后的意义和目的。

      ### 2. 比特币钱包的类型

      热钱包与冷钱包

      热钱包是指始终连接到互联网的钱包,方便用户进行在线交易,但相对不太安全。冷钱包则是离线存储,适合长时间存储比特币。

      软件钱包与硬件钱包

      软件钱包包括手机和电脑应用,易于使用,适合日常交易; 硬件钱包是物理设备,提供更高的安全性,适合大额存储。

      纸钱包的介绍

      纸钱包是将比特币地址和私钥打印在纸上的一种存储方式,完全离线,不易被攻击,但需要妥善保存。

      ### 3. 比特币地址的构成

      地址的基础知识

      比特币地址是用户接收比特币的唯一标识,通常由字符串表示,长度为26到35个字符。

      不同类型的比特币地址

      比特币有多种地址格式,例如传统的 P2PKH(以1开头),P2SH(以3开头)和新推出的 Bech32(以bc1开头),各自有不同特点与应用场景。

      地址与公钥、私钥的关系

      比特币地址是通过对公钥进行哈希运算而产生,而公钥则是由私钥生成的。私钥是用户掌握比特币控制权的唯一凭证,因此必须妥善保存。

      ### 4. 比特币地址生成的过程

      钱包如何生成私钥

      在比特币网络中,私钥是一个随机生成的256位二进制数。钱包使用加密算法来生成这个私钥,确保其唯一性和安全性。

      如何从私钥生成公钥

      公钥是通过应用椭圆曲线加密算法(ECDSA)将私钥进行转换而得到的,这个过程是数学上可以逆的,确保了从公钥无法反向推导出私钥。

      地址的哈希和编码过程

      生成的公钥通过SHA-256和RIPEMD-160算法进行哈希处理,最终编码为比特币地址。这一过程确保了地址的安全性和唯一性。

      ### 5. 无数个地址的优势与必要性

      隐私保护

      通过生成多个比特币地址,用户可以在每次交易时使用不同的地址,增加隐私性,降低被追踪的风险。

      防止地址重用的风险

      重用地址会使交易历史透明化,增加被盗的风险。因此,频繁生成新地址可以降低这些风险,增强安全性。

      管理多个账户的灵活性

      很多比特币钱包支持多重地址管理,使用户可以方便地掌握不同的存储和交易账户,便于资金的分配和管理。

      ### 6. 常见问题解答

      为什么比特币钱包能生成无数个地址?

      比特币钱包的设计允许用户生成无数个地址,是基于公钥密码学的原理和随机数生成技术。一个私钥可以产生对应的公钥,而公钥可以通过多次哈希运算生成不同的比特币地址。钱包在生成这些地址时,使用高强度的随机数,以确保每个地址的唯一性。此设计的核心目的是保护用户的隐私,例如,通过频繁更换地址,可以防止别有用心的人对资金流向的追踪。

      如何管理和使用多个比特币地址?

      管理多个比特币地址通常依赖于钱包软件的功能。大多数现代钱包都提供了该功能,用户可以轻松查看和管理多个地址及其余额。通过标签或文件夹系统,用户能将不同用途的地址进行分类和标识。此外,使用硬件钱包还可以将这些地址托管在离线设备上,提升安全性。

      比特币的地址与交易的安全性关系是什么?

      比特币地址与交易的安全性息息相关。每个地址的安全性取决于私钥的保护,若私钥被泄露,控制该地址的比特币随时可能被盗用。使用新的地址可以降低追踪风险及减少盗窃的可能性。通过哈希算法生成的地址,能有效地让黑客无法从交易记录中识别出相应的私钥。

      是否可以从比特币地址恢复私钥?

      一般情况下,是不可能从比特币地址直接获得私钥的。比特币地址是通过复杂的数学运算生成的,故此为单向的。不论是从地址逆推到公钥还是私钥,都是不可行的。因此,务必妥善保存私钥,防止丢失或泄露。

      地址生成的随机性如何保证?

      比特币钱包在生成地址时,使用了高质量的随机数生成器(CSPRNG),保证生成过程中的随机性与不可预测性。这样的设计可以确保数万亿个可能的私钥,几乎不可能被破解。同时,每次生成新地址时,都会涉及到大量随机数学运算,以增强安全性。

      如何选择适合自己的比特币钱包?

      选择比特币钱包时可以考虑多个因素,包括安全性、易用性、所需功能(如多地址管理、恢复选项)、用户评价及社区支持。热钱包适合小额交易,冷钱包更适合长期存储大额。有条件的话,硬件钱包是提高资金安全性的最佳选项。用户也可以从多个钱包中进行比较,选择最符合自身需求的WATCH。不同种类的钱包都有自己的优势与局限,了解这些信息将帮助更好地进行选择与使用。

      ### 7. 总结

      通过深入探讨比特币钱包生成无数个地址的技术原理,可以看到这一设计在隐私保护和安全性方面的重要作用。随着加密货币逐渐进入主流,钱包技术的发展也将不断演进,我们期待未来会有更多的创新。